引言
数控车床编程是制造业中的一项关键技术,它涉及到复杂的数学计算、几何图形处理以及机床操作等多个方面。对于初学者来说,数控车床编程往往充满了挑战。本文将针对数控车床编程中的实战填空题进行解析,并提供一些实用的技巧,帮助读者克服编程难题。
一、数控车床编程基础
1.1 数控车床简介
数控车床是一种通过计算机程序控制的车床,它能够自动完成各种复杂的加工任务。数控车床编程就是编写控制机床运行的程序,实现零件的加工。
1.2 编程语言
数控车床编程通常使用G代码和M代码。G代码用于控制机床的运动,如移动、定位等;M代码用于控制机床的辅助功能,如开关冷却液、主轴旋转等。
二、实战填空题解析
2.1 基本运动指令
填空题:G00 X______ Z______;
解析:此题考查G00指令的使用。G00为快速定位指令,X和Z分别代表X轴和Z轴的定位坐标。例如,G00 X100 Z50表示机床快速移动到X轴100mm和Z轴50mm的位置。
2.2 车削循环
填空题:N10 G90 G96 S1200 M03;
解析:此题考查车削循环的使用。G90为精车循环,G96为恒速切削循环。S1200表示主轴转速为1200r/min,M03表示主轴正转。该指令表示机床以1200r/min的转速进行精车加工。
2.3 子程序调用
填空题:N20 G81 P100 Q50;
解析:此题考查子程序调用的使用。G81为固定循环指令,P100表示子程序号,Q50表示循环次数。该指令表示调用子程序100进行循环加工50次。
三、编程技巧全攻略
3.1 熟练掌握编程语言
要成为一名优秀的数控车床编程人员,首先需要熟练掌握G代码和M代码。
3.2 熟悉机床结构
了解机床的结构和工作原理,有助于更好地编写程序。
3.3 练习编程技巧
通过大量练习,提高编程速度和准确性。
3.4 注意编程规范
遵循编程规范,提高程序的可读性和可维护性。
四、总结
数控车床编程是一项技术性很强的技能,需要不断学习和实践。通过本文的解析和技巧全攻略,相信读者能够更好地掌握数控车床编程,解决编程难题。
